WEIGHT WATCHERS FRIENDLY MEXICAN RICE
We love Mexican rice but don't want to use all of our WW points eating it. My solution was to add lots of zero point veggies! There's only 1/2 cup uncooked white rice in the whole thing.

Steps:
- 1. Lightly spray non stick skillet with oil.
- 2. Add rice and cook over med heat until opaque. Add onion and garlic and saute lightly.
- 3. Add water and spices including salt and pepper. If you like a more red rice like in a restaurant, add a teaspoon of paprika.
- 4. Add rest of ingredients except peas and fresh cilantro. Cover, reduce heat to low, and cook for 20 minutes. Stir occasionally and add more water if needed. Depends on how juicy the tomatoes are.
- 5. Add the peas and cilantro during the last 5 minutes. Taste test for salt and tenderness of rice before serving.
- 6. note: I calculate there are 14 points on the blue Weight Watchers plan for the whole thing! At 4 huge servings that's 3.5 points. Great with chili.
WEIGHT WATCHERS CORE MEXICAN RICE

Steps:
- Heat oil. Add rice and cook until golden and toasted. Add and lightly saute onion, bell pepper, and garlic.
- Put salt, 1/2 cup of tomatoes (undrained) and broth in a blender. Process till smooth.
- Add liquid from blender to the rice mixture slowly. You can drain the rest of the tomatoes and add them to the rice at this point if you want extra tomato.
- Bring to a boil, cover, turn heat to low, and simmer until rice is tender, about 1 hour. (Or however long brown rice needs to simmer - my package says 1 hour.)
- Don't remove the lid during the cooking process.
- If you don't have fresh garlic, you can add 1/2 teaspoon of garlic powder to the blender.

MEXICAN RICE WW
Now I am pretty picky when it comes to my mexican rice. This was actually good considering its weight watchers.

Steps:
- 1. Heat oil in skillet. Add rice until golden and toasted. Add onion and pepper and lightly sautee.
- 2. In a blender put salt,garlic, 1/2 cup tomatoes (undrained) and broth. Puree until smooth.
- 3. Slowly add liquid mixture to rice. You can drain the rest of the tomatoes and add to the rice if you'd like.
- 4. Bring to a boil, cover and turn heat to low. Simmer until rice is tender, about 1 hour. Do not remove lid while rice is simmering! I usually check the rice package, it tells you how long to cook it for.

MEXICAN-STYLE BROWN RICE CASSEROLE | RECIPES | WW USA
From weightwatchers.com
Cuisine MexicanCategory DinnerServings 6Total Time 55 mins
- Preheat oven to 375ºF. Coat a 2-quart rectangular, round, or oval baking dish with cooking spray
- In a large bowl, combine rice, salsa, and cumin. Spoon 2 cups of rice mixture into prepared baking dish and spread out to evenly cover bottom of dish.
- In another large bowl, combine refried beans, corn, chili peppers, and chili power. Using a rubber spatula, scrape bean mixture on top of rice layer and smooth out top.
- Squeeze out any excess water from spinach or collard greens and then spread on top of bean layer; sprinkle with 6 Tbsp cheese. Top with remaining rice mixture and smooth out top; sprinkle with remaining cheese.
MEXICAN RICE, CORN, AND CHEESE CASSEROLE | RECIPES | WW …
From weightwatchers.com
Cuisine MexicanCategory Lunch,DinnerServings 6Total Time 51 mins
- Heat the oil in a large Dutch oven or flameproof and ovenproof casserole over medium-high heat. Add the bell pepper and cook, stirring occasionally, until tender, about 5 minutes. Add the scallions, garlic, and Cajun seasoning.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the scallions are soft, about 2 minutes. Add the rice, stirring until well coated.
- Stir the tomatoes, broth, onions, corn, and chiles into the casserole; bring to a boil. Remove from the heat and cover. Bake until most of the liquid is absorbed and the rice and vegetables are tender, about 20 minutes.
- Remove the cover, then sprinkle the casserole with the tomato and cheese. Return to the oven and bake, uncovered, until the cheese melts, about 5 minutes longer. Serve the casserole sprinkled with the cilantro. Yields generous 1 cup per serving.
